My client are a leading designer and manufacturing of packaging for the UK retail market. For the last 4 decades, this business has been at the forefront of innovation, sustainability, and manufacturing processes within their sector.

We are looking for an experienced Accounts/Administration Assistant to join the Finance team on a full-time basis, working closely with the Sales, Finance and Customer Services departments and providing variety of administrative tasks across the business.

As part of this role, you will provide support to the Finance Manager on a variety of accounting tasks, including end of month accounts, payroll and purchasing duties. This diverse and varied role offers an exciting opportunity for the successful candidate. Applicants will need a high degree of initiative and self-motivation, combined with the ability to be versatile, and have confidence to take on extra responsibilities where required.

Applicants should have strong knowledge of SAGE, MS Office and a variety of internal systems such as Phoenix (CRM). Good written and verbal communication skills are required with a background in being the first line of contact for all customer, supplier and business based enquires.
